Urgent Care — Nurse Practitioner Career Context
Of the 50 active Urgent Care listings this role was benchmarked against, 36% are remote, 28% have no call, 54% require no weekends.
For production-based offers, this specialty runs a typical 5,000 wRVUs per year (derived from CMS CPT-frequency data), and WeekdayDoc listings compensate a median of about $50 per wRVU — implying roughly $250k in production-based pay. For reference, the 2026 CMS Medicare conversion factor is $33.40 per RVU.
